Step 7: Cutting over the alert fan-out. Drain the legacy Stormlane dispatcher, verify the new fan-out workers have claimed all county partitions, and confirm zero unacknowledged alerts remain. Only then repoint the subscription tracker at the new alerts database using the connection string below.

primary connection of yagep-kahip = redis://giliel_svc:zYiKsLL2PLpfPL@db-348f.xolmarsys.corp:5432/fenwyn

This page covers break-glass access for Furrow, the farm-equipment telemetry gateway. Short version: you should almost never need this. If the gateway's auth service falls over and tractors stop reporting, normal logins won't work, so we keep an emergency path. SSH to the gateway's serial console, pick "emergency session" from the boot menu, and you'll get one shot at the passphrase prompt — get it wrong and the box reboots. For future maintainers stuck at 2 a.m., the recovery passphrase is below.

strongbox words: norwyn-wenael-aldvan-aldiel-wendor-holael

Facilities ticket — Halewick Tower, night shift.

Issue: support team reporting east stairwell reader rejecting badges after midnight. Reader was reset this morning; firmware updated. Overnight crew should now badge as normal. If the reader fails again, use the manual keypad by the fire door — do not prop the door. Log any further failures with the time and badge name. Temporary keypad code for the fallback door is below.

door code, tajeg-fawip: bdg-K-62

Log sampling for Chirpwell. The relay service emits ~40k lines/min; we keep 1% at INFO, 100% at WARN+. Sampling config lives in the Fennel deploy repo under telemetry/. Don't raise the INFO rate without checking Lanternview storage quotas first. To change sampling in an emergency you need the recovery passphrase, which is:

vault phrase of kafog-kahif = holdor-rusir-praox

FAQ: StormPing fan-out

Q: Alerts delayed on release day?
A: Fan-out workers pause during deploy. Drain the Gustline queue first, then ship. If workers stall, restart via the Cloudmere console. Console access requires the ops vault. The vault unlocks with the recovery passphrase below.

unlock words, yagep-fahof: belix-rusvan-casdor-gorox-aldath-norael-istix-quenael-fraeth-silael